Estimates for the commutator of bilinear Fourier multiplier [PDF]
The bilinear Fourier multipliers are a class of operators which has attracted a lot of attention of matematicians recently. Following the pioneering work of R. R. Coifman and Y. Meyer, which established boundedness of bilinear operators with very smooth symbols, a lot has been done to clarify the precise smoothness conditions on the symbol.
